Calories and Macronutrients

A typical chicken sandwich of medium size contains around 350 calories. However, the calorie count can vary depending on the type of bread and toppings used. Whole grain bread, for example, is a healthier option than white bread. Grilled or baked chicken is also a better choice than deep-fried chicken. In addition to calories, chicken sandwiches also contain macronutrients like protein, carbohydrates, and fats. A medium-sized chicken sandwich can offer around 27 grams of protein, 50 grams of carbohydrates, and 12 grams of fat. It is important to watch your portions to ensure you don't consume too many calories or exceed your daily recommended intake of macronutrients.

Healthy Sandwich Options

To make your chicken sandwich healthier, start with the bread. Whole grain bread is a good option as it is high in fiber and nutrients. You can also try using pita bread or wraps for a change. Next, choose your protein wisely. Go for grilled or baked chicken instead of deep-fried chicken as it is healthier and lower in calories. You can also add some protein-rich toppings like avocado or hummus. Finally, choose your condiments carefully. Skip the mayo and go for healthier options like mustard, yogurt, or vinaigrette dressing. You can also add some fresh veggies like lettuce, tomatoes, or cucumber for added nutrition.

Dietary Restrictions

If you have dietary restrictions, you can still enjoy a chicken sandwich. For gluten-free options, you can use gluten-free bread or lettuce wraps instead of regular bread. For dairy-free options, skip the cheese and use a dairy-free condiment like mustard or hummus. For those following a low-carb diet, you can skip the bread altogether and wrap the chicken in lettuce leaves. You can also add some low-carb toppings like bacon or cheese. By making a few adjustments, you can still enjoy a delicious chicken sandwich that fits your dietary needs.

Nutritional Values of 1 sandwich (343 g) Chicken (Medium)

UnitValue
Calories (kcal)350 kcal
Fat (g)18 g
Carbs (g)11 g
Protein (g)42 g

Calorie breakdown: 43% fat, 12% carbs, 45% protein
